What to Stream This Weekend

Over the past few months, livestream concerts have become an innovative part of the new normal. Artists are recording performances from their abodes for late night television and they’re also teaming up for virtual music festivals. This weekend, you can catch a livestream from Rainbow Kitten Suprise’s Sam Melo and Jason Isbell as well as a star-studded festival hosted by House Party. Take a look at your possible weekend plans below:

The Black Keys Replay

This Friday at 9 a.m. The Black Keys will release Live At The Crystal Ballroom on YouTube. Recorded in April 2008 in Portland, Oregon, the film will be available for only 72 hours. Watch it on the band’s YouTube channel.

In The House

Social networking app Houseparty is hosting a three-day virtual festival from May 15-17. In The House features over 40 entertainers and artists performing, giving cooking lessons, doing workout videos, singing karaoke and more. The star-studded lineup includes Zooey Deschanel, Terry Crews, Alicia Keys and Snoop Dogg. View the full lineup here.
